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Grantham to Ashburys start from as little as £14.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Grantham to Ashburys are available for £65.70 one way, or £95.40 return

Facilities and Amenities at Grantham Station

Grantham Station is dedicated to ensuring you have everything you need for a convenient journey. The ticket office operates with ample access across all seven days of the week, complemented by ticket machines for easy ticket collection. Accessibility is a key priority, with step-free access throughout the station, accessible ticket machines, and ramps available for smooth train access. The station lounges and heated waiting rooms offer a comfortable space to relax, complete with accessible seating options.

Traveling with luggage or have specific needs? Although there are no luggage storage facilities, the station staff is on hand to assist where possible, and feedback is welcomed to improve services. Secure station accreditation, customer information screens, and on-site CCTV ensure safety and security. Plus, you can always refresh at the coffee shops or access cash from the available ATM machines for your journey.

Onward Travel from Grantham Station

Once you've arrived at Grantham, onward travel is a breeze. Taxis are readily available, and Grantham Taxis can be pre-booked to ensure your ride. Buses are conveniently accessible, with detailed information about local services available for planning more extensive travels. Rail replacement services also depart directly from the station's front, ensuring minimal disruption to your travel plans. Facilities and Amenities at Ashburys Station

Ashburys Train Station, being a small local station, lacks some of the amenities commonly found in larger facilities. There is no ticket office, ticket machines, or smartcard validators, which means commuters must secure their tickets online or ahead of time. For those requiring assistance, note that there is no staff help or customer help points available; however, an induction loop is installed for those with hearing aids.

Accessibility at Ashburys requires some preplanning due to the absence of step-free access and tactile paving. For travelers requiring ramp access, boarding ramps are available on all trains. Although the station does not host waiting rooms, accessible toilets, or refreshment options, seating is provided.

Onward Travel from Ashburys Station

Traveling onward from Ashburys is relatively straightforward. Rail replacement services pick up and drop off under the railway bridge on Pottery Lane. For taxi services, you can find details and book via the Northern Railway's Cab4You service. Need to plan a bus trip? Printable formats for your onward journey information are available here. Unfortunately, there are no underground or metro services directly linked to Ashburys, but comprehensive travel plans can be shaped with a bit of initiative.
